Types of Dentures:

Full Dentures: Restoring a Complete Smile

Full dentures are the ideal solution when all teeth are missing. They consist of a gum-colored base that fits over the gums, holding artificial teeth.

Facets:

  • Role: Restores chewing function, improves speech, and enhances aesthetics.
  • Examples: Traditional full dentures, implant-supported full dentures.
  • Risks and Mitigations: Potential issues include slippage, discomfort, and bone resorption. Regular adjustments and good oral hygiene help mitigate these risks.
  • Impacts and Implications: Full dentures require careful cleaning and maintenance to ensure longevity.

Summary: Full dentures offer a practical solution for complete tooth loss, providing a functional and aesthetically pleasing smile. They require regular maintenance to ensure optimal performance and comfort.

Partial Dentures: Filling the Gaps

Partial dentures are custom-designed to replace missing teeth while preserving existing teeth. They are usually made of acrylic or metal, with artificial teeth attached to a framework.

Facets:

  • Role: Improve chewing function, enhance appearance, and prevent further tooth loss.
  • Examples: Flexible partial dentures, metal framework partial dentures.
  • Risks and Mitigations: Potential concerns include loosening, breakage, and discomfort. Proper care and regular adjustments minimize these risks.
  • Impacts and Implications: Partial dentures require regular cleaning and maintenance to preserve their structure and functionality.

Summary: Partial dentures are a valuable option for individuals with missing teeth, providing a natural-looking and comfortable restoration. They offer stability and improve the functionality of the mouth.

Immediate Dentures: A Temporary Solution

Immediate dentures are inserted immediately after tooth extraction, offering a temporary solution until permanent dentures are ready.

Facets:

  • Role: Provide a temporary denture solution, minimizing the downtime after tooth extraction.
  • Examples: Traditional immediate dentures, implant-supported immediate dentures.
  • Risks and Mitigations: Potential issues include discomfort, slippage, and the need for adjustments. Regular visits to the dentist are essential.
  • Impacts and Implications: Immediate dentures are temporary and will need to be replaced with permanent dentures once the gums heal.

Summary: Immediate dentures are a convenient option that helps maintain the shape of the gums during the healing process. They are designed to be temporary and require careful handling and maintenance.

FAQ

Q: What are the different materials used for dentures? A: Dentures can be made from various materials, including acrylic, porcelain, and composite. The choice of material depends on factors like durability, aesthetics, and cost.

Q: How long do dentures last? A: The lifespan of dentures varies depending on the type, materials, and individual oral care habits. With proper care, dentures can last for several years.

Q: How much do dentures cost in Bedford? A: The cost of dentures in Bedford varies greatly depending on the type of denture, materials, and additional services. It's essential to get quotes from multiple providers to compare prices.

Q: Are dentures covered by insurance? A: Most dental insurance plans provide partial coverage for dentures. However, the coverage amount varies depending on the plan.

Q: Do denture providers offer financing options? A: Many denture providers offer flexible payment plans or financing options to make dentures more affordable.
